- 博客(23)
- 收藏
- 关注
原创 Mybatis-Generator代码生成工具
Mybatis-Generator添加插件 <plugin> <groupId>org.mybatis.generator</groupId> <artifactId>mybatis-generator-maven-plugin</artifactId> <version>1.4.0</version> <config
2023-06-29 17:02:37
361
原创 docker安装mysql
外部机器不能和docker中 mysql 容器 直接访问 , 但是可以通过挂载交互数据,,这就需要在启动容器的时候设置好-v 的内容,当然这只是打通了容器和宿主,如果是windows,先要连接linux下的docker的mysql,则需要设置3306端口的防火墙,具体操作百度.Docker 安装mysql1.拉取镜像2.创建映射目录 (也可以手动创建文件夹,但如果是mac可能会有权限问题,chmod777 即可解决,尽量用命令)3.进入到创建的mysql目录中 (就是刚才自己创建的目录)
2023-06-29 16:57:07
83
1
原创 从服务器上拉去代码到本地
1、在idea里2、把git服务器的代码地址复制过来直接贴在url点clone 克隆输入你在git上的账号密码即可在new windows打开即可
2022-02-17 10:42:19
1320
1
原创 .gitignore设置忽略提交的文件
设置需要忽略的提交文件在提交代码的时候,很多文件时不需要提交的,.gitgnore就是设置那些文件不需要提交:# 忽略所有路径下的mvnw文件**/mvnw# 忽略所有路径下的mvnw.cmd文件**/mvnw.cmd# 忽略所有路径下的.MVN目录**/.mvn# 忽略所有路径下的target目录,这是打包之后生成的,本地打包用的不需要提交**/target/ # 忽略.idea文件夹,该文件下包括版本控制信息、历史记录.idea**/.gitignore上传只上传
2022-02-17 10:29:12
922
原创 代码生成器 generator
代码生成器 generator的使用适用版本:mybatis-plus-generator 3.5.1 及其以上版本,由于生成器代码不需要提交维护,代码放在test包下面即可1、引入依赖<dependency> <groupId>com.baomidou</groupId> <artifactId>mybatis-plus-generator</artifactId> <version>3.5.1</
2022-02-12 16:48:32
1665
原创 OSS对象存储
1、引入oss-starter <dependency> <groupId>com.alibaba.cloud</groupId> <artifactId>spring-cloud-starter-alicloud-oss</artifactId></dependency>2、配置key、endpoint设置key用子用户添加访问权限在配置文件中 aliclo
2021-04-11 12:25:51
127
原创 逻辑删除
逻辑删除是为了方便数据恢复和保护数据本身价值等等的一种方案,但实际就是删除。如果你需要频繁查出来看就不应使用逻辑删除,而是以一个状态去表示。#使用方法:步骤1: (高版本是默认的 不用配置) application.yml mybatis-plus: global-config: db-config: logic-delete-field: flag # 全局逻辑删除的实体字段名(since 3.3.0,配置后可以忽略不配置步骤2
2021-04-09 09:23:33
417
原创 Postman使用方法
1、 点 + 新建 2、 请求写入(协议://ip:端口/请求) Controller层中 @RequestMapp(类请求+方法请求) 3、 选择请求方式此处用POST请求 因为delete方法有数组参数、参数在@RequestBody 请求体里传递、SOST请求有请求体 GET请求没有请求体,所以用POST请求 @RequestMapping("/delete") //rerquestBody 获取到请求体里的内容,只有PSOST请求有请.
2021-04-09 09:06:46
258
原创 vue显示数据
请求发送、拿到数据在vue里如何显示<template> <el-tree :data="menus" :props="defaultProps" @node-click="handleNodeClick"> </el-tree></template> <!--:data="menus" ,数据绑定、绑定data()的属性menus,用于显示数据 props="defaultProps" 显示方式绑定 绑定的是defaultProp
2021-04-08 19:46:37
1894
原创 {“msg“:“invalid token“,“code“:401} 问题解决
非法令牌、如果没有登录、没有访问权限、访问就出现检查是否登录检查路由的顺序精确路由放在高优先级、模糊路由放在低优先级spring: cloud: gateway: routes: - id : product_route uri: lb://gulimall-fast predicates: - Path=/api/product/** filters: .
2021-04-08 18:54:34
18403
原创 跨域请求访问
服务1 ---->网关 ----> 服务2(网关和服务都要加入到注册中心中去 加依赖 写地址 加注解)1、服务1 -->网关(port:88)在.js文件中定义了api接口的请求地址 (地址改为网关地址88,并加上api请求,方便网关断言处理)服务1发送请求后,请求头:此时说明 给网关发送成功在网关 application.yml 中 设置网关转发predicates断言条件满足 网关就转发给 uri 地址 lb负载均衡spring: cl...
2021-04-08 18:19:18
925
原创 多级菜单 多级分类 递归实现
如上图电脑/办公 菜单 里面有子菜单 电脑整机 、 电脑配件 、外设产品、 游戏设备 ...理解为:电脑/办公 菜单对象有一个 类型为 List<菜单>的属性 这个list里面都是菜单对象 如 电脑整机 、 电脑配件 、外设产品、 游戏设备分级菜单其实就是菜单对象里面有子菜单 属性(如果数据库该表中没有这个列可以在 属性上面加 @TableField(exist = false))class CategoryEntity{ @TableField(exist = .
2021-04-08 12:11:56
1102
2
原创 Failed to configure a DataSource: ‘url‘ Failed to determine a suitable driver class 问题解决
Error starting ApplicationContext. To display the conditions report re-run your application with 'debug' enabled.2021-04-07 13:11:31.250 ERROR 9336 --- [ main] o.s.b.d.LoggingFailureAnalysisReporter : ***************************APPLICATION
2021-04-07 13:25:13
291
原创 npm install出错 Error 问题解决
pm ERR! code ELIFECYCLEnpm ERR! errno 1npm ERR! phantomjs-prebuilt@2.1.15 install: `node install.js`npm ERR! Exit status 1npm ERR! npm ERR! Failed at the phantomjs-prebuilt@2.1.15 install script.npm ERR! This is probably not a problem with npm. There
2021-04-06 10:08:35
2103
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人